now the unsavory fact. in the states where the polls show obama leading by 1-3 points in the polls, do not be surprised if he loses the state. there is something called the Bradley effect. basically it is the fact that some people will not tell pollers that they will not vote for a black person but when they vote they do let their prejudice take control. not the way it should be, but it is there. there are not as many bigots as there once was but there are still some bigots out there.
